The Itinerary and Scenic Highlights

The cruise sets sail from Split Port in the early evening, providing an ideal window to catch the sunset. The route is designed to highlight some of the most iconic sights of the coast, making it a visual feast. As the boat gently glides through the waters, you’ll first pass the lush Marjan Park Forest, a sprawling green area that dominates the skyline and offers a stark contrast to the shimmering sea. Many travelers appreciate how the boat offers a different perspective of this beloved park, which is often explored on land.

Then, the boat heads toward Iovo Island, one of the small islands in the vicinity known for its quiet charm and natural beauty. The movement of the boat, combined with the sunset, creates a peaceful, almost meditative backdrop. If you’re lucky with the timing and weather, the sky turns into a canvas of oranges, pinks, and purples, offering breathtaking photo opportunities.

The Iconic Sights: Diocletian’s Palace and the Riva

One of the main attractions from the water is the view of Diocletian’s Palace—a UNESCO World Heritage site that dates back to Roman times. The illuminated walls and towers glow softly as night approaches, giving a fairy-tale quality to the scene. The Riva promenade, bustling during the day with cafes and street performers, transforms into a twinkling display of lights. Seeing these landmarks from the water gives a fresh perspective, highlighting their grandeur against the natural backdrop of the sunset.

Practical Details and Value

The price of $33 per person is quite reasonable considering the scenic value, especially with the included champagne. For travelers on a budget, it offers a relaxing way to enjoy the coast without high costs. The tour lasts enough time for a good sunset view but is not overly long, making it suitable for those with tight schedules.

The language of the tour is English, making it accessible for most travelers. Booking can be flexible with a “reserve and pay later” option, which is handy if plans change unexpectedly. However, it’s important to note that the tour is not suitable for wheelchair users and pets are not allowed—something to consider if you have specific needs or travel companions with pets.
